Skip to content

Conversation

@crsanti
Copy link
Member

@crsanti crsanti commented Mar 7, 2017

Updated ValidationEngine and ValidationDispatcher.
Updated spec files.

This closes #42.

@crsanti crsanti self-assigned this Mar 7, 2017
@brauliodiez
Copy link
Member

brauliodiez commented Mar 7, 2017

Missing to update sample applications?

// TODO: Implement Issue #15
addFieldValidation(key: string, validation: (vm, value) => FieldValidationResult, filter?: any);
addFieldValidationAsync(key: string, validation: (vm, value) => Promise<FieldValidationResult>, filter?: any);
addFieldValidation(key: string, validation: (value, vm) => FieldValidationResult, filter?: any);
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

We should type vm as optional, isn't it?

addFieldValidation(key: string, validation: (value, vm?) => FieldValidationResult, filter?: any);

@brauliodiez brauliodiez merged commit af8ff25 into master Mar 7, 2017
@brauliodiez brauliodiez deleted the issue42-invertvalidationparameters branch March 7, 2017 14:17
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Invert validation function parameters order

4 participants